sql >> Database teknologi >  >> RDS >> Oracle

Oracle MED CLAUSE virker ikke?

Jeg tror, ​​du har en tom linje i dit script mellem WITH-sætningen og SELECT:

SQL> WITH
  2  test AS
  3  (
  4  SELECT COUNT(Customer_ID) FROM Customer
  5  )
  6  
SQL> select * from test;
select * from test
              *
ERROR at line 1:
ORA-00942: table or view does not exist

Det er i overensstemmelse med det faktum, at du fik fejlen rapporteret som værende på "linje 1" og SQL "vælg * fra test", når denne SQL skulle være på "linje 6".



  1. Hvorfor ændres ora_rowscn uden at opdatere en tabel

  2. LEFT OUTER JOIN på matrixkolonne med flere værdier

  3. Syntaksfejl med IF EXISTS UPDATE ANDERS INSERT

  4. Slet den samme række indsat i en tabel med trigger i mysql